The Town of Westport, MA has levels of Trihalomethanes above Drinking Water Standards. Our water system recently violated a drinking water standard. Although this is not an emergency, as our customers, you have a right to know what happened, what you should do, and what we are doing to correct this situation. We routinely monitor for the presence of drinking water contaminants. Tests results for the 3rd and 4th quarter of 2012 as well as the 1st quarter of 2013 shows that our system exceeds the standard, or maximum contaminant level (MCL), for Trihalomethanes. The standard for Trihalomethanes is 0.080 mg/L. The average level for Trihalomethanes for the 3rd quarter of 2012 was 0.09817 mg/L; the average level for the 4th quarter of 2012 was 0.09557 mg/L; and the average level for the 1st quarter of 2013 was 0.09547 mg/L.
What should I do?
You do not need to use an alternative (e.g. bottled) water supply. However, if you have specific health concerns, consult your doctor.
What does this mean?
This is not an immediate risk. If it had been, you would have been notified immediately. However, some people who drink water containing Trihalomethanes (TTHM’s) in excess of the MCL over many years may experience problems with their liver, kidneys or central nervous system and may have an increased risk of getting cancer.
What happened? What is being done?
We will increase flushing the water distribution system. We will sample the water at the entry point, mid point and end point to evaluate the results and plan accordingly to address this water quality compliance issue and correct the problem.

PUBLIC NOTICE
The Fall River Water Division is implementing major electrical improvements at our Drinking Water Treatment Facility. This requires at least two temporary shutdowns of the facility (meaning no water shall be pumped). The shutdowns shall be scheduled for Sunday mornings as this is our lowest demand period.
The planned shutdowns are as follows:
- May 12, 2013 – estimate a 4 hour shutdown.
- May 26, 2013 – estimate a 6 hour shutdown.
There is also the potential for shutdowns on May 19 and/or June 2 dependent on the rate of construction.
During these shutdowns we shall use the limited water in our storage tanks. WE ASK THAT ALL USERS MINIMIZE THEIR WATER USE!
Customers may experience low water pressure, rusty water and in some cases short term loss of water during the shutdown.
Please CONSERVE during these dates.
